- [ ] **Step 7: Breaker override escrow.** After sealing the signing keys for the Tallgrove upstream API circuit breaker, confirm the support team can force the breaker open during a full outage. The override bundle lives in the sealed escrow drawer and is useless without its unlock phrase. Two ceremony witnesses must initial this step before proceeding. The escrow bundle is decrypted with the recovery passphrase that follows.

vault phrase of kahip-kahop = holath-quenmir

# Brindle Rules Engine — environment configuration
# This file configures the shipping-fee rules engine for the staging tier.
# All rule definitions are fetched at boot from the internal rules registry
# and cached for 15 minutes; no rules are evaluated client-side.
# Nothing in this file is logged, and the file is excluded from backups.
# The registry fetch is authenticated with the credential set below:

secret setting of yagef-baweg: RELAY_SECRET29=cb53deb59a49ed54d9f43599b54ca

Memo to Sales Leads — Next Year's Headcount

Hi all — quick update on the headcount plan. We're cleared for six new hires across the sales org next year: four field roles in the Daxbury and Pellwick patches, plus two inside sales seats. Backfills are approved automatically; net-new roles need sign-off from Priya. Draft your territory cases by month-end. One more thing you should know before you plan, noted confidentially below.

internal memo for kagup-hahof: The northern region missed its Briix quota by 44.1 percent last quarter. Pelixek Freight plans to raise the Gorael list price by 50.0 percent in September. The finance team signed off on a budget of $502.5 million for Project Ralys. The renewal with Quenionax Works closes at $163.8 million a year, 15.3 percent above the last contract.

Subject: Goods Lift Reservation — Overnight Deliveries

Dear night shift team,

The goods lift at Harwick House is reserved for Pellam Logistics deliveries between 22:00 and 04:00 all this week. Please keep the lift lobby clear of trolleys and pallets, and log each delivery in the dock book. The lift door on level B1 stays locked; you'll need the pass below to release it.

door code, yagag-yajog: bdg-PO-2